Exemplo n.º 1
0
 public function save(Default_Model_TempFiles $model)
 {
     $data = array('userId' => $model->getUserId(), 'fileName' => $model->getFileName(), 'type' => $model->getType(), 'fileType' => $model->getFileType(), 'fileSize' => $model->getFileSize());
     if (null === ($id = $model->getId())) {
         $data['created'] = new Zend_Db_Expr('NOW()');
         $id = $this->getDbTable()->insert($data);
     } else {
         $this->getDbTable()->update($data, array('id = ?' => $id));
     }
     return $id;
 }
Exemplo n.º 2
0
 public function deleteProjectUploadAction()
 {
     $return = '';
     $fileId = $this->getRequest()->getParam('fileId');
     $tempFiles = new Default_Model_TempFiles();
     if ($tempFiles->find($fileId)) {
         $return = $tempFiles->getType();
         $tempFile = APPLICATION_PUBLIC_PATH . '/media/temps/' . $tempFiles->getFileName();
         @unlink($tempFile);
         $tempFiles->delete();
     }
     echo Zend_Json_Encoder::encode($return);
 }